Synthesis of Benzaldehyde Glycol Acetal Catalyzed by CePW_(12)O_(40)

XU Zhao-hui

Open publisher page 0 citations

Abstract

Benzaldehyde glycol acetal was synthesized from benzaldehyde and ethylene glycol in the present of(CePW_(12)O_(40)).The factors influencing the synthesis were discussed and the better conditions were found as follows: based on 0.1 mol benzaldehyde,the molar ratio of benzaldehyde to ethylene glycol is 1.0/1.7,the quantity of catalyst is equal to 1.0% of the feed stock,the amount of tulene 10 mL and the reaction time is 2.0 h.Under the above conditions its yield can reach over 79.5%.
